> When running the  [distributed MNIST LeNet example | 
> https://github.com/apache/systemml/blob/master/scripts/nn/examples/mnist_lenet_distrib_sgd.dml],
>  each mini-batch could ideally run in parallel without interaction. We try to 
> force {{parfor (j in 1:parallel_batches)}} at line 137 of 
> {{nn/examples/mnist_lenet_distrib_sgd.dml}} to be {{parfor (j in 
> 1:parallel_batches, mode=REMOTE_SPARK, opt=CONSTRAINED)}} use 
> {{REMOTE_SPARK}} mode, but got some errors about 
> {{org.apache.sysml.runtime.DMLRuntimeException: Not supported: Instructions 
> of type other than CP instructions}}. More log information can be found at 
> the following comments. One example of the errors is that at the convolution 
> layer, we need to randomly generate a matrix, but SystemML choose 
> {{RandSPInstruction}} instead of {{DataGenCPInstruction}}, which may be 
> because SystemML could not determine the row number of the matrix. For this 
> distributed MNIST LeNet  example, using CPInstruction may achieve better 
> performance.
